Australia - Export of Lead-Acid Electric Accumulators (Vehicle)

Since 2014, Australia Export of Lead-Acid Electric Accumulators (Vehicle) was up 40% year on year. With $2,429,317.55 in 2019, the country was number 62 comparing other countries in Export of Lead-Acid Electric Accumulators (Vehicle). Australia is overtaken by Greece, which was number 61 with $2,719,066 and is followed by Latvia at $2,413,408.63. South Korea ranked the highest with $1,890,012,613.2 in 2019, that is a growth of 3.9% compared to 2018. Germany, United States and Spain resp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Nicaragua witnessed the best average annual growth at +162% per year, while Armenia recorded the worst performance at -68.7% per year.
